This one hit deep.
In this episode, I share a real, raw parenting moment that honestly felt like failure… but turned out to be one of my biggest wins.
After building a simple, loving connection ritual with my son, saying “I’m so happy to see you,” he shocked me one morning with, “I’m so sad to see you.” And yeah… it hurt.
Instead of reacting the way my past self would have, I paused. I breathed. I chose to respond as my favorite self.
